To thrive in Fruit Packaging, you need attention to detail, physical stamina, and the ability to follow health and safety guidelines; a high school diploma is often sufficient. Familiarity with packaging machinery or conveyor belt systems is helpful, and some companies may require basic food handling certifications. Reliability, teamwork, and a strong work ethic help you excel in a fast-paced, collaborative environment. These skills ensure products are safely and efficiently prepared for distribution, maintaining quality and meeting tight deadlines.
